Gratitude Unlocks Joy: 1 Thessalonians 5:16-18
In 1 Thessalonians 5:16-18, Paul encourages believers to “rejoice always, pray continually, give thanks in all circumstances,” reminding us that gratitude is not dependent on perfect conditions but on a heart anchored in God. This passage teaches that joy flows naturally when we choose to be thankful, even during struggles, because thanksgiving shifts our focus from problems to God’s presence and provision. By cultivating a grateful spirit, we unlock deeper joy and peace, living in alignment with God’s will for our lives.
A Daily Gift of Gratitude: Psalm 118:24
Psalm 118:24 declares, “This is the day that the Lord has made; let us rejoice and be glad in it,” reminding us that every day is a gift from God. This verse calls us to approach each new day with gratitude, regardless of what it brings, because God is the giver of time and life itself. Choosing to rejoice daily is an act of faith, showing trust in God’s plan and embracing His blessings with a thankful heart. Gratitude in each moment transforms ordinary days into opportunities for joy and worship.
Let Christ’s Peace Rule: Colossians 3:15

Colossians 3:15 encourages believers to let the peace of Christ rule in their hearts, reminding us that gratitude and unity go hand in hand. When we allow Christ’s peace to guide our thoughts and actions, we experience harmony with God and others. A thankful heart helps us surrender control, trust God’s plan, and live in peace, even when life feels uncertain.
Pray Away Anxiety, Receive Peace: Philippians 4:6-7
Philippians 4:6-7 teaches that when we bring our worries to God in prayer with a spirit of thanksgiving, His peace guards our hearts and minds. Gratitude shifts our focus from anxiety to God’s faithfulness, allowing His presence to calm our restless spirits. This peace is beyond human understanding and is rooted in complete trust in Him.
Grace Over Bitterness: Hebrews 12:15
Hebrews 12:15 warns us to guard against bitterness, which can take root and harm both us and those around us. Gratitude helps us resist resentment by reminding us of God’s grace and blessings. When we choose thankfulness, we make room for healing, peace, and stronger relationships grounded in grace.
Forgiveness Frees Us – Ephesians 4:31-32
Ephesians 4:31-32 calls us to let go of anger, bitterness, and malice, and instead forgive others just as God forgave us. Forgiveness is a powerful act of gratitude, acknowledging God’s mercy in our own lives. When we extend that mercy to others, we experience freedom, peace, and the joy of living in love.
Remember His Deeds, Rejoice: Psalm 9:1-2

Psalm 9:1-2 reminds us to give thanks with our whole hearts, remembering the marvelous works God has done. Gratitude flows when we recall His past faithfulness, giving us reason to rejoice in every season. Praising Him with joy strengthens our trust and keeps our hearts focused on His goodness.
Joy in Trials Builds Strength: James 1:2-3
James 1:2-3 encourages us to count it all joy when facing trials because challenges strengthen our faith and endurance. Gratitude in hardship may not come easily, but it transforms struggles into opportunities for growth. By trusting God through difficulties, we develop resilience and a deeper joy that endures.
A Joyful Heart Brings Healing: Proverbs 17:22
Proverbs 17:22 tells us that a cheerful heart is like good medicine, bringing health and life to the soul. Gratitude nurtures joy within us, which has the power to heal both emotionally and physically. Choosing thankfulness lifts our spirits and allows us to spread encouragement to others.
Gratitude Sparks Overflowing Joy: Isaiah 12:4-6
Isaiah 12:4-6 highlights the joy that springs from remembering God’s goodness and declaring His name with thanksgiving. Gratitude fuels worship and inspires us to share His works with others. When we give thanks for His salvation and mighty deeds, our hearts overflow with joy, and we become living witnesses of His love.
